This flag features a green field symbolizing the lush island vegetation, with a yellow, black, and white cross representing the native Carib people, Christianity, and pure water. At the center, a red disk bears a Sisserou Parrot, emblematic of the island's fauna. Ideal for representing Dominica's rich biodiversity, its Carib heritage, and its commitment to environmental
